package main
//creates a client and uses that to call a protobuf.
import (
"bufio"
"bytes"
"flag"
"fmt"
"github.com/hailo-platform/H2O/hshell/send"
"io/ioutil"
"log"
"os"
"strings"
)
const (
GitProtoHome = "github.com/hailo-platform/H2O/protobufs/services"
IMPORT = "%IMPORT%"
REQUEST = "%REQUEST%"
RESPONSE = "%RESPONSE%"
ENDPOINT = "%ENDPOINT%"
OUTPUT = "%OUTPUT%"
REQUESTUPDATE = "%REQUESTUPDATE%"
SERVICE = "%SERVICE%"
CLIENTTEMPLATE = `
package main
import (
"github.com/hailo-platform/H2O/protobuf/proto"
"github.com/hailo-platform/H2O/platform/client"
"time"
"os"
"strings"
log "github.com/cihub/seelog"
"flag"
"fmt"
%IMPORT%
)
var _ = proto.String("NOOP")
func init() {
logger, err := log.LoggerFromConfigAsFile("seelog.xml")
if err != nil {
log.Debugf("Failed to load logger config from seelog.xml %v", err)
} else {
log.ReplaceLogger(logger)
log.Info("Custom logging enabled")
}
}
func main() {
defer log.Flush()
reqNumber := flag.Int("number", 1, "Number of iterations")
outFile := flag.String("output", "", "Location of the output log")
flag.Parse()
req := %REQUEST%
endpoint := "%ENDPOINT%"
service := "%SERVICE%"
fo, err := os.Create(*outFile)
if err != nil {
log.Error("output file creation failed:", err)
return
}
// close fo on exit and check for its returned error
defer func() {
if err := fo.Close(); err != nil {
log.Error("Cannot close output file:", err)
return
}
}()
writeChan := make(chan MessageData)
done := make(chan int)
go WriteOutput(fo, writeChan, done)
for i :=0; i < *reqNumber; i++ {
%REQUESTUPDATE%
request, err := client.NewRequest(
service,
endpoint,
req,
)
if err != nil {
log.Error(err)
return
}
rsp := &%RESPONSE%
ts := time.Now()
errReq := client.Req(request, rsp)
duration := time.Since(ts)
if errReq != nil {
writeChan <- MessageData{
ep: service +"."+endpoint,
rt: duration,
status: "false",
rs: 0,
err: errReq,
h: "",
r: "",
}
continue
}
%OUTPUT%
writeChan <- MessageData{
ep: service +"."+endpoint,
rt: duration,
status: "true",
rs: 0,
err: err,
r: rsp,
}
}
close(writeChan)
<-done
}
type MessageData struct {
ep string
rt time.Duration
status string
rs int
err ErrorResponse
h Header
r Response
}
type Header interface{}
type Response interface{}
type ErrorResponse interface{}
func WriteOutput(fo *os.File, writeChan chan MessageData, done chan int) {
for md := range writeChan {
toWrite := ""
results := fmt.Sprintf("%+v", md.r)
header := fmt.Sprintf("%+v", md.h)
results = fmt.Sprintf("\"%s\"", strings.Replace(results, "\"", "\"\"", -1))
header = fmt.Sprintf("\"%s\"", strings.Replace(header, "\"", "\"\"", -1))
ts := time.Now()
toWrite += fmt.Sprintf("%v,", ts.UnixNano())
toWrite += md.ep + ","
toWrite += fmt.Sprintf("%v,", md.rt.Nanoseconds())
toWrite += md.status + ","
toWrite += string(md.rs) + ","
if md.err != nil {
toWrite += fmt.Sprintf("%+v,", md.err)
} else {
toWrite += ","
}
toWrite += fmt.Sprintf("%+v,", results)
toWrite += fmt.Sprintf("%+v", header)
fo.WriteString(toWrite + "\n")
}
done <- 1
}
`
)
func main() {
outputFile := flag.String("output", "test-client.go", "Output filename")
importStr := flag.String("protobuf", "", "The import protobuf path, ie. go-banning-service/audit")
requestStr := flag.String("go", "", `The request object in native Go ie. "Name: proto.String(\"Moddie\"),"`)
endpointStr := flag.String("endpoint", "", "The endpoint to hit ie. com.hailocab.banning.retrieve")
jsonStr := flag.String("json", "", "the request object as json")
hint := flag.Bool("hint", false, "Give you a peek at the protobuf. Won't actually run the request")
defaultReq := flag.Bool("default", false, "if true, send the default request")
update := flag.Bool("update", false, "update Go files. That is the protobuf, the protobuf library and the client library")
flag.Parse()
tmpDir, err := send.CreateTempDir()
if err != nil {
log.Println("error creating tempdir", err)
}
origGoPath := os.Getenv("GOPATH")
os.Setenv("GOPATH", tmpDir)
defer os.Setenv("GOPATH", origGoPath)
protoArr := strings.Split(*importStr, "/")
err = send.GoGet(*importStr, *update)
if err != nil {
log.Println("problem getting code")
return
}
pbfile := fmt.Sprintf("%s/src/%s/%s.proto", tmpDir, *importStr, protoArr[len(protoArr)-1])
data, err := ioutil.ReadFile(pbfile)
if err != nil {
log.Println("Could not read protos:", pbfile)
}
pbreader := bytes.NewReader(data)
pbioreader := bufio.NewReader(pbreader)
pb := send.ParseProtobufRaw(pbioreader, protoArr[len(protoArr)-1], true, tmpDir)
if *hint {
send.PrintHint(pb)
send.PrintJsonExample(pb)
return
}
if *defaultReq {
*jsonStr, _ = send.PrintJsonExample(pb)
}
var req string
if *jsonStr != "" {
req = send.ConstructJsonRequest(pb, *jsonStr)
for _, pbVal := range pb {
if pbVal.Root {
*importStr = pbVal.Name + " \"" + *importStr + "\"\n\"encoding/json\""
}
}
} else {
req = send.ConstructRequest(pb, *requestStr)
for _, pbVal := range pb {
if pbVal.Root {
*importStr = pbVal.Name + " \"" + *importStr + "\""
}
}
}
rsp := send.ConstructResponse(pb)
outputStr := ""
service, endpoint := send.SeparateService(*endpointStr)
crArr := []send.ClientReplace{
send.ClientReplace{Find: IMPORT, Replace: *importStr},
send.ClientReplace{Find: REQUEST, Replace: req},
send.ClientReplace{Find: RESPONSE, Replace: rsp},
send.ClientReplace{Find: ENDPOINT, Replace: endpoint},
send.ClientReplace{Find: OUTPUT, Replace: outputStr},
send.ClientReplace{Find: SERVICE, Replace: service},
send.ClientReplace{Find: REQUESTUPDATE, Replace: ""},
}
rdrstr := strings.NewReader(CLIENTTEMPLATE)
rdr := bufio.NewReader(rdrstr)
_, err = send.WriteClient(rdr, crArr, *outputFile)
if err != nil {
log.Println("Error writing client:", err)
}
}
